Would like to know which BW (1501 or 1502)was factory installed in the Session 500, cannot locate the model configuration on the speaker....Thank you.

Peavey used the 1502-4 in the Session 500's.

The early Nashville 400's also used that same 1502-4 speaker.

One way to tell the difference is, the 1501 has a smooth cone and the 1502 has a ribbed cone.

If it has a 1501-4 speaker that was not the original speaker or it was custom ordered with the 1501.

I had one of the original (small cabinet) Session 500's and it came with the 1502-4. I've seen several on display at the ISGC in St Louis, back when they were produced, including the newer larger cabinet models and the stage amps provided by Peavey, and they were all the 1502-4 speaker.

Yours is an exception. I have (or at least had) an old Peavey brochure and it listed the 1502-4 as the speaker in the Session 500.

My Session 500 was one piece (the preamp, power supply and power amp sections were mounted together, not separate). I suspect the two piece assembly was because of the export model and 220V mains.
